The Benefits Of Electronic Invoicing Software

In today’s fast-paced business world, efficiency and accuracy are key factors for success. One way that businesses can streamline their operations and improve their bottom line is by using electronic invoicing software, also known as e-invoicing software. This technology allows businesses to create, send, and manage invoices electronically, rather than relying on traditional paper-based methods. In this article, we will explore the benefits of electronic invoicing software and why businesses should consider making the switch.

First and foremost, electronic invoicing software offers significant time savings for businesses. With traditional paper invoicing, employees have to manually create and send out invoices, which can be a time-consuming process. However, with electronic invoicing software, businesses can automate this process, saving valuable time and allowing employees to focus on more strategic tasks. In addition, electronic invoicing software can also streamline the payment process by allowing businesses to easily track and manage payments in real-time.

Another benefit of electronic invoicing software is improved accuracy and reduced errors. With traditional paper invoicing, human error is always a risk, whether it be in the form of incorrect calculations, missing information, or lost invoices. electronic invoicing software helps to eliminate these errors by providing built-in validation checks and ensuring that all required information is included before an invoice is sent out. This can help businesses avoid costly mistakes and disputes with clients, ultimately leading to better customer relationships and increased trust.

Additionally, electronic invoicing software can help businesses save money by reducing paper and postage costs. By sending invoices electronically, businesses can eliminate the need for paper, envelopes, and stamps, which can add up to significant savings over time. In addition, electronic invoicing software can also help businesses reduce the amount of storage space needed for paper invoices, as all invoices are stored electronically in the cloud. This can help businesses become more environmentally friendly and streamline their operations at the same time.

Furthermore, electronic invoicing software can help businesses improve their cash flow and accelerate the payment process. With traditional paper invoicing, invoices can get lost in the mail or delayed in processing, leading to delays in payment from clients. electronic invoicing software allows businesses to send invoices instantly and track when they have been viewed and paid, helping to reduce the time it takes to receive payment. This can help businesses improve their cash flow and have more control over their finances.

In addition to these benefits, electronic invoicing software also offers enhanced security features to protect sensitive financial information. With traditional paper invoicing, businesses are at risk of invoices being lost, stolen, or tampered with. electronic invoicing software encrypts all financial data and provides secure access to authorized users only, helping to protect businesses from fraudulent activities. This can give businesses peace of mind knowing that their financial information is safe and secure.

Overall, electronic invoicing software offers numerous benefits for businesses looking to streamline their operations, improve efficiency, and reduce costs. By automating the invoicing process, businesses can save time, improve accuracy, and accelerate the payment process. In addition, electronic invoicing software can help businesses save money on paper and postage costs, reduce errors, improve cash flow, and enhance security. With all of these benefits, it’s no wonder that more and more businesses are making the switch to electronic invoicing software.
